How they compare
Hungary currently reports 0.4228 against 0.3854 in Austria, a difference of 0.0374.
That makes Hungary's figure about 1.1 times Austria's.
Across all 15 years both countries report, Hungary has been ahead every year.
Austria ranks 23rd and Hungary ranks 21st of 69 countries.
Hungary has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Austria | Hungary |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 0.3486 | 0.4624 | 0.1138 | Hungary |
| 2010s | 0.3847 | 0.4091 | 0.0244 | Hungary |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
